The hosts of the podcast discuss various sports topics, including the Texas Rangers' recent success in the playoffs and their upcoming series against the Houston Astros. They also talk about the Dallas Stars' season opener and the Dallas Cowboys' recent losses and concerns about their performance. They express disappointment in the Cowboys' quarterback Dak Prescott and the play-calling of the offensive coordinator. Overall, they feel that the Rangers and Stars have potential for success, but have doubts about the Cowboys. Welcome to officially episode 2 of the spod pod.
